Adding a bit of Cow hide 2 my ride

I just so happen 2 be one of the people who did not get an Epxo with the Eddie Bauer package or the leather. ( I know, I know)

Yet the price was just right! (In LA things cost more than they should at times)

So now I'm contemplating on adding that good ol' leather 2 my expo.
Has anyone done this, and if so what steps, and measures did you take?

I just did the Katzkin kit in my ride, real moo cow. Install took me about 3 hours not rushing. Got it from Roger at the F150online store.

You remove the factory cloth and install the leather. E-mail Roger for pricing. I'm sure Nav seats are quite a bit more and the Katzkin leather I like better then any of the factory leather. Super high dollar vehicles is another story.

Yes, all 3 rows, except that I already had experience taking the covers off, but it's not really any big deal on the factory one, they wip right off. The Katzkins are what take time. You can strip the factory cover of in minutes but puting the leather on............Plus I learned some tricks from the pro's. But all in all, it's not so bad. Plus I ordered mine without the arm rests bec I have the 2000 console so I shaved off the arms and had Katzkin make it smooth.
